HJR0542 is a resolution introduced in the Tennessee General Assembly that recognizes and honors Earlene Teaster, the City Manager of Pigeon Forge. The resolution acknowledges her contributions to the city and highlights her role in local governance. This measure primarily affects the city of Pigeon Forge and serves to formally commend Teaster for her service.
